Abstract

The utility model discloses a kind of sliding bush apparatus of working stability, cylindrical boss and telescopic including hollow structure, telescopic is connected by hiding located at its internal rotating shaft with the upper end of boss, and the cavity inner wall of boss, which is sticked, noise reduction strip of paper used for sealing, and telescopic transfer shaft extension enters in the cavity of boss;The lower end of boss is provided with a screw mandrel and one end of screw mandrel is stretched into the cavity of boss, and it is connected with rotating shaft, the one end of screw mandrel away from telescopic is provided with micromachine, micromachine is used to drive T-shaped screw mandrel to rotate, extend a circle limited block in the axis direction of the lower ending opening edge of boss towards boss, screw mandrel is T-shaped screw mandrel, i.e. one end diameter of the screw mandrel away from telescopic is more than the internal diameter of limited block, the utility model not only increases operating efficiency, reduce scrappage, it is time saving and energy saving, it is energy-efficient, and reduce production cost.

Description

A kind of sliding bush apparatus of working stability
Technical field
Auto-parts technical field is the utility model is related to, more particularly, to a kind of sliding bush apparatus of working stability.
Background technology
Sliding bush apparatus is a part particularly important in auto-parts, and in the prior art, traditional sliding bush apparatus is present Cause well damage because long-term use of, manual control, the shortcomings of noise is big, long-term use of learies are very big, add production Funds, to improve operating efficiency, reduce production cost, control noise, save manpower, the utility model proposes one kind work is steady Fixed sliding bush apparatus.
Utility model content
Technical problem to be solved in the utility model is, the shortcomings that for above prior art, proposes that a kind of work is steady Fixed sliding bush apparatus, include the cylindrical boss and telescopic of hollow structure, telescopic is by hiding located at its internal rotating shaft It is connected with the upper end of boss, the cavity inner wall of boss, which is sticked, noise reduction strip of paper used for sealing, and telescopic transfer shaft extension enters in the cavity of boss;
The lower end of boss is provided with a screw mandrel and one end of screw mandrel is stretched into the cavity of boss, and is connected with rotating shaft, silk The one end of bar away from telescopic is provided with micromachine, and micromachine is used to drive T-shaped screw mandrel to rotate, the lower ending opening edge of boss Extend a circle limited block towards the axis direction of boss, screw mandrel is T-shaped screw mandrel, i.e. one end diameter of the screw mandrel away from telescopic More than the internal diameter of limited block.
The technical scheme that the utility model further limits is:
The sliding bush apparatus of foregoing working stability, the internal diameter phase of one end external diameter that T-shaped screw mandrel is stretched into boss and limited block With suitable.
The sliding bush apparatus of foregoing working stability, used between T-shaped screw mandrel and micromachine and be welded and fixed connection.
The sliding bush apparatus of foregoing working stability, the material of noise reduction strip of paper used for sealing are noise reduction silicon rubber, the material of noise reduction silicon rubber For polysiloxanes high molecular polymer.
The sliding bush apparatus of foregoing working stability, the material of telescopic is stainless steel.
The beneficial effects of the utility model are:It is cavity structure inside boss by the technical solution of the utility model, and T-shaped screw mandrel is provided with cavity, micromachine starts the reciprocating movement of T-shaped screw mandrel, and the reciprocating motion of T-shaped screw mandrel is flexible so as to drive The stretching motion of set, the full-automatic activity that this series of motion all uses, eliminates artificial part, improves work effect Rate, it is time saving and energy saving, noise reduction strip of paper used for sealing is provided with boss cavity, the shortcomings that traditional sliding sleeve noise is big is changed, improves the reality of sliding sleeve With property, production cost is reduced, and the technical scheme is simple in construction, it is easy to use, safeguard simple.
Brief description of the drawings
Fig. 1 is the utility model structure diagram;
Wherein:1- boss, 2- telescopics, 3- rotating shafts, 4- noise reduction strip of paper used for sealings, 5- screw mandrels, 6- micromachines, 7- limited blocks.
Embodiment
The utility model is described in further detail below:
A kind of sliding bush apparatus for working stability that the present embodiment provides, including the cylindrical boss 1 of hollow structure and stretch Contracting set 2, telescopic 2 are connected by hiding located at its internal rotating shaft 3 with the upper end of boss 1, and the material of telescopic 2 is stainless steel Material, the cavity inner wall of boss 1, which is sticked, noise reduction strip of paper used for sealing 4, and the material of noise reduction strip of paper used for sealing 4 is noise reduction silicon rubber, noise reduction silicon rubber Material is polysiloxanes high molecular polymer, in telescopic 2 rotating shaft 3 stretch into the cavity of boss 1;
The lower end of boss 1 is provided with a screw mandrel 5 and one end of screw mandrel 5 is stretched into the cavity of boss 1, and is connected with rotating shaft 3 Connect, the one end of screw mandrel 5 away from telescopic 2 is provided with micromachine 6, and micromachine 6 is used to drive T-shaped screw mandrel to rotate, T-shaped screw mandrel with Using connection is welded and fixed between micromachine 6, the axis direction of lower ending opening edge towards the boss 1 of boss 1 is extended One circle limited block 7, screw mandrel 5 is T-shaped screw mandrel, i.e., one end diameter of the screw mandrel 5 away from telescopic 2 is more than the internal diameter of limited block 7, T-shaped The internal diameter of one end external diameter and limited block 7 that screw mandrel is stretched into boss 1 matches.
So by the technical solution of the utility model, boss inside is cavity structure, and T-shaped screw mandrel is provided with cavity, Micromachine start T-shaped screw mandrel reciprocating movement, the reciprocating motion of T-shaped screw mandrel so as to drive the stretching motion of telescopic, this The full-automatic activity that the motion of series all uses, eliminates artificial part, improves operating efficiency, time saving and energy saving, and boss is empty Intracavitary is provided with noise reduction strip of paper used for sealing, changes the shortcomings that traditional sliding sleeve noise is big, improves the practicality of sliding sleeve, reduce and be produced into This, and the technical scheme is simple in construction, it is easy to use, safeguard simple.
